In chapter seven, “Second Lives/Second Chances: Promoting Social Inclusion,” Maria Lucia Piga examines the link between social and environmental problems in the context of participative social policies in Italy. She shows how social cooperatives, especially those that are involved in recycling, reclamation, and inclusive agriculture represent a symbiotic solution that fosters socio-environmental alliances. Summary of chapter seven: Environment protection against social justice? Social policy as a key tool for durable development. What kind of social policy? The turning point. Inclusion by work as an innovation for the integrated social policies system.Second lives / second chances: a social-environmental alliance to prevent social exclusion.
